Your car is your trusted companion on the road, getting you wherever you need to be quickly and safely. But like most machines, there comes a time when it won’t run as well as it used to. You might find yourself spending more on gas or contending with annoying engine noises. When this happens, you might find yourself considering your options.
This is where an auto tuneup comes in. This preventative maintenance service replaces your car’s old fluids and worn-out parts, giving it a fresh breath of life. And when done regularly, it will extend the life of your car. That said, what are some things you should expect during an auto tuneup?
Fluid replacement. Your car relies heavily on fluids such as engine oil and coolant to operate. These fluids can deplete or become contaminated, resulting in excessive wear on your car’s internal parts. So, it’s essential that they are checked and replaced, if necessary, during an auto tuneup.
Ignition parts replacement. Ignition parts are responsible for getting your engine up and running whenever you turn the ignition key. They include spark plugs and wires, and they, too, wear out with time. Therefore, they should be replaced regularly, which you can expect when necessary during an auto tuneup.
Filter replacement. Filters are vital in protecting your engine from contaminants like dust and moisture. These particles will build up gradually on your filters, making them dirty and inefficient. Therefore, they need to be replaced regularly to avoid engine performance issues.
